At the heart of the boom is a simple demographic reality: we're living longer, but not always healthier. Chronic conditions like arthritis, mobility issues, and neurodegenerative diseases are more common in older adults, making quality long-term care a necessity. For care facilities, this means rethinking every aspect of resident care—and nursing beds are ground zero. "A good nursing bed isn't just about comfort," says Maria Gonzalez, a long-term care administrator with 15 years of experience in California. "It's about preventing pressure sores, reducing staff injuries from lifting, and letting residents maintain a sense of dignity by adjusting their position on their own."
This shift is reflected in the aged nursing bed market , which industry reports suggest is growing at a steady 5-7% annually. Beyond demographics, other factors are at play. For one, families are more involved than ever in choosing care facilities, and they're asking tough questions about equipment. "Ten years ago, families might not have thought twice about the type of bed their parent was using," Gonzalez notes. "Now, they want to see features like electric adjustments, built-in scales, and even USB ports for charging devices. They're treating this decision like they would buying a home—because, in many ways, it is a home."
Regulatory changes are also pushing facilities to upgrade. Governments in Europe, North America, and parts of Asia have tightened safety standards, mandating features like anti-entrapment rails and weight capacity limits. In the U.S., for example, the Centers for Medicare & Medicaid Services (CMS) now requires regular inspections of nursing beds to ensure they meet federal guidelines. For facilities, this often means replacing older manual beds with newer models that check all the compliance boxes.
Gone are the days of one-size-fits-all nursing beds. Today's manufacturers are prioritizing customization and multifunctionality, creating beds that adapt to individual needs rather than forcing residents to adapt to the bed. Let's break down the key trends:
Walk into a facility that's invested in modern equipment, and you'll likely hear the soft hum of electric motors. Electric nursing beds now dominate the market, and for good reason. Unlike manual beds, which require staff to crank handles to adjust height or position, electric models let residents (or caregivers with a remote) raise the head, knees, or entire bed with the push of a button. This isn't just about convenience—it's about independence. "I had a resident who, after a stroke, couldn't use her left arm," recalls James Lee, a certified nursing assistant (CNA) in Seattle. "With her electric bed, she could still adjust the headrest to read or watch TV by herself. That small act of control meant the world to her."
Electric nursing bed manufacturers are doubling down on this trend, adding features like memory settings (so a resident's preferred positions are saved) and low-height options to reduce fall risks. Some models even sync with health monitoring apps, sending alerts to staff if a resident tries to get up unassisted—a game-changer for preventing injuries.
A "multifunction nursing bed" today might include everything from built-in massage functions to integrated pressure redistribution systems. Take the "Fair Price Multifunction Nursing Bed" line, popular in parts of Asia and Europe. These beds often come with side rails that fold down automatically, under-bed lighting to prevent nighttime falls, and even built-in commode features for residents with limited mobility. "It's about reducing the need to transfer residents unnecessarily," explains Dr. Raj Patel, a geriatrician in London. "Every transfer carries a risk of falls or strain. If a bed can adapt to bathing, toileting, or eating, it keeps residents safer and more comfortable."
Customization is also key. Facilities catering to bariatric residents now opt for extra-wide beds with reinforced frames, while those focusing on post-surgery rehabilitation might choose beds with built-in traction capabilities. In Singapore, where space is at a premium, nursing bed Singapore suppliers have introduced foldable models that save room when not in use—a hit with smaller facilities.
Not all nursing bed demand is coming from large facilities. As more families choose to care for elderly relatives at home, there's a growing market for portable, user-friendly models. Enter the oem portable nursing bed trend—manufacturers are creating lightweight, foldable beds that can be easily moved between rooms or even transported in a van. These beds often sacrifice some advanced features for portability but still include essentials like height adjustment and basic positioning.
"We've seen a 30% increase in home care bed sales since 2020," says David Chen, a sales manager at a china multifunction nursing bed factory. "During the pandemic, families couldn't visit facilities, so many chose to bring care home. Our portable models became popular because they're easy to set up and don't require a professional installer."
With so many options, how do facilities choose? Let's compare the most common types on the market today:
Bed Type | Key Features | Best For | Price Range (USD) |
---|---|---|---|
Basic Manual Bed | Hand-crank adjustments for head/knees; fixed height; minimal extras | Facilities with tight budgets; residents with minor mobility issues | $500 – $1,200 |
Standard Electric Bed | Electric adjustments for head/knees/height; basic safety rails; weight capacity ~350 lbs | Most long-term care facilities; home care for moderate mobility needs | $1,500 – $3,000 |
Multifunction Electric Bed | Full-body adjustment; built-in scale; USB ports; anti-entrapment rails; weight capacity up to 500 lbs | Rehabilitation centers; bariatric units; high-end assisted living | $3,000 – $8,000 |
Portable/Foldable Bed | Lightweight; foldable frame; battery-powered options; basic adjustments | Home care; temporary stays; facilities with limited space | $800 – $2,000 |
The aged nursing bed market isn't one-size-fits-all geographically. Cultural preferences, economic factors, and healthcare infrastructure shape demand in unique ways.
In North America and Europe, where labor costs are high, electric and multifunction beds are the norm. Facilities prioritize features that reduce staff workload, like automatic bed height adjustment (to prevent back injuries from lifting) and integrated patient monitoring. "In Germany, we're seeing a trend toward 'smart beds' that connect to the facility's nurse call system," says Anna Schmidt, a healthcare technology consultant in Berlin. "If a resident tries to get up, the bed alerts the nurse's station instantly. It's proactive care, not reactive."
In Asia, the market is more price-sensitive, but that's changing. Countries like Japan and South Korea, with rapidly aging populations, are investing heavily in high-tech beds. Meanwhile, in Southeast Asia—including nursing bed Malaysia and Singapore—facilities are balancing affordability with quality, often opting for mid-range electric beds with essential features. "Many facilities here start with basic electric models and upgrade as they grow," Chen explains. "There's also a demand for beds that accommodate cultural practices, like lower heights for caregivers who prefer to assist while kneeling."
China, a major player in manufacturing, is both a producer and a consumer. China electric nursing bed manufacturers dominate the global supply chain, exporting to over 100 countries. Domestically, the focus is on meeting the needs of rural areas, where home care is more common, and urban facilities, which are adopting smart bed technology at a rapid pace.
Despite the positive trends, the nursing bed market faces hurdles. Cost is a major barrier, especially for smaller facilities or those in low-income regions. A top-of-the-line multifunction bed can cost as much as a used car, and with facilities often needing dozens of beds, the upfront investment is steep. "We wanted to upgrade all our beds to electric models, but with 80 residents, that's $240,000 upfront," says Gonzalez. "We had to phase it in over three years, applying for grants and diverting funds from other budgets."
Supply chain issues, which plagued the industry during the pandemic, are also lingering. Components like electric motors and specialized fabrics are still in short supply in some regions, leading to delays in deliveries. "We ordered 10 new beds in January 2023 and didn't get them until June," Lee recalls. "In the meantime, we were patching up old manual beds with duct tape and extra pillows. It wasn't ideal for residents or staff."
Then there's training. Newer beds come with a learning curve. "Our staff was used to manual beds, so when we got electric ones with touchscreen remotes, there was a lot of confusion," Gonzalez laughs. "We had to bring in reps from the manufacturer for workshops. Now, the CNAs love them—but it took time."
Looking ahead, the nursing bed of 2030 might look more like a "health hub" than a traditional bed. Manufacturers are already experimenting with IoT (Internet of Things) integration, adding sensors that track heart rate, blood pressure, and sleep patterns. Imagine a bed that alerts staff if a resident's oxygen levels drop overnight, or one that automatically adjusts to prevent pressure sores by shifting the resident's weight subtly throughout the night.
Sustainability is another focus. With facilities under pressure to reduce their carbon footprint, electric nursing bed manufacturers are exploring solar-powered models and recyclable materials. "We're testing beds with lithium-ion batteries that can be charged via solar panels," Chen notes. "For rural areas with unreliable electricity, this could be a game-changer."
Customization will go even further, with beds tailored to specific conditions. For example, beds designed for residents with Parkinson's might include vibration features to reduce tremors, while those for post-surgery patients could have built-in physical therapy aids like leg exercisers.
